Understanding Sash Windows
Sash windows are defined by their distinct moving mechanism, which enables the window panes to move up and down within a frame. This design, stemming in the 17th century, integrates type and function, offering ventilation and natural light. In many regions, sash windows are considered a crucial element of a structure's historic stability and beauty.

Common Questions about Sash Window RepairFRE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ION
Q: How do I know if my sash windows require repair?A: Signs include difficulty opening/closing, drafts, condensation between glass panes, or visible rot on the wood frame.

Q: How long does sash window repair typically take?A: The duration varies based upon the degree of the damage, however minor repairs can take a few hours, while more comprehensive restoration may last several days.

Q: Can I perform repairs myself?A: While small repairs can be DIY jobs, it's advised to employ certified technicians for more extensive concerns to ensure appropriate restoration.

Q: What products are utilized in sash window repairs?A: Certified technicians generally utilize standard materials like wood, putty, and hardware created specifically for sash window systems.
